Sometime ago a financial institution entered a swap where it agreed to receive 3.9% per annum with semi-annual compounding and pay LIBOR every six months on $100 million. The swap has exactly 9 months left, and the next exchange is in 3 months. The three-month LIBOR rate is 4% per annum with semi-annual compounding. The six-month LIBOR that was determined 3 months ago is 4.2% per annum with semi-annual compounding. The forward LIBOR rate for the 3-to-9- month period is 4.6% per annum with semi-annual compounding. The OIS zero rate for 3 months is 3.1% per annum with continuous compounding. The OIS forward rate for the 3-to-9- month period is 3.7% per annum with continuous compounding. Obtain the value of the swap for the financial institution
